SELECT TO_CHAR(my_timestamp_column, 'YYYY-MM-DD HH24:MI:SS') AS my_timestamp_str FROM my_table; 复制代码 在这个示例中,my_timestamp_column是TIMESTAMP类型的列,使用TO_CHAR函数将其转换为字符串,并指定了日期和时间的格式(‘YYYY-MM-DD HH24:MI:SS’)。在实际使用中,可以根据需要选择不同的日...
SELECT TO_CHAR(timestamp_column, 'YYYY-MM-DD HH24:MI:SS') AS timestamp_string FROM your_table; 复制代码 在上述示例中,timestamp_column是包含时间戳的列名,your_table是表名。TO_CHAR函数将时间戳转换成指定格式的字符串,'YYYY-MM-DD HH24:MI:SS’是日期时间格式化字符串,可以根据需要进行调整。 运...
在Oracle中将时间戳转换为日期列,可以使用TO_TIMESTAMP函数和TO_CHAR函数来实现。 首先,TO_TIMESTAMP函数用于将时间戳转换为日期时间格式。它的语法如下: TO_TIMESTAMP(timestamp_exp, [format_mask], [nls_language]) 其中,timestamp_exp是要转换的时间戳表达式,可以是一个字符串或一个日期时间值。format_mask...
在Oracle中,可以使用TO_CHAR函数将时间戳转换为特定的时间格式。以下是一个示例: SELECTTO_CHAR(your_timestamp_column,'YYYY-MM-DD HH24:MI:SS')ASconverted_timeFROMyour_table; 在上面的示例中,your_timestamp_column是包含时间戳的列名,your_table是包含该列的表名。YYYY-MM-DD HH24:MI:SS是你想要转换...
timestamp转换为char: SELECT to_char(SYSTIMESTAMP,'yyyy-mm-dd HH24:mi:ss:ff') FROM dual;---24小时制 SELECT to_char(SYSTIMESTAMP,'yyyy-mm-dd HH:mi:ss:ff am') FROM dual;---12小时制 char转换为timestamp: select to_timestamp('2015-6-2 12:34:56.789', 'yyyy-mm-dd hh24:mi:ss....
注:所以,timestamp要算出两日期间隔了多少秒,要用函数转换一下。 to_char函数支持date和timestamp,但是trunc却不支持TIMESTAMP数据类型。 DATE数据类型 可以存储月,年,日,世纪,时,分和秒。度量粒度是秒 以使用TO_CHAR函数把DATE数据进行传统地包装,达到表示成多种格式的目的 ...
SQL>selectto_timestamp(to_char(sysdate,'yyyy-mm-dd hh24:mi:ss'),'yyyy-mm-dd hh24:mi:ss')fromdual 或者使用CAST函数进行转换也行,示例如下: SQL>SELECT CAST(date1 AS TIMESTAMP)"Date"FROM t; 同理,date到timestamp,也可利用CAST函数进行转换。
首先使用TO_CHAR函数将时间戳转换为字符串,然后使用TO_NUMBER函数将字符串转换为数字。 3、直接进行算术运算: 通过对时间戳的各个组成部分进行加权求和,可以得到一个代表时间点的数值。 详细转换步骤: 1、使用EXTRACT函数提取时间组件: 假设我们有一个时间戳字段timestamp_column,我们可以使用EXTRACT函数提取年、月、日...
Oracle timestamp类型可以使用to_char函数转换为13位时间戳: SELECT to_char(timestamp_column, 'YYYY-MM-DD HH24:MI:SS.FF3') AS timestamp_13 FROM table_name; 发布于 1 年前 本站已为你智能检索到如下内容,以供参考: 🐻 相关问答 3 个 1、Java时间戳转 oracle TIMESTAMP类型 2、Python 获取13位...